Long-Range-Ambient-FM-Backscatter-for-Coded-Point-to-Point-Commu...
《Long-Range-Ambient-FM-Backscatter-for-Coded-Point-to-Point-Communications: 劳拉系统详解》 “劳拉”系统是一种基于环境FM信号的长距离无线反向散射通信技术,其核心是利用环境中的FM广播信号作为传输媒介,实现点对点的数据通信。这种技术具有低功耗、低成本和长距离通信的特点,特别适用于物联网(IoT)设备之间的通信。本文将深入探讨劳拉系统的工作原理、关键技术以及Python在其中的应用。 一、工作原理 1. 反向散射通信:反向散射通信是一种非传统的通信方式,它不依赖于传统的发射器和接收器,而是通过反射或散射现有电磁波来传递信息。在劳拉系统中,设备通过改变其反射FM信号的幅度或相位,编码并发送数据。 2. 环境FM信号:劳拉系统利用广泛存在的FM广播信号,这些信号覆盖范围广,能量充足,可以为通信提供可靠的载体。设备捕获FM信号,对其进行处理后,再将其散射回环境中,形成一个可解码的信息流。 3. 点对点通信:与传统的广播通信不同,劳拉系统采用点对点的方式,允许单个设备精确地向另一个设备发送数据,而不是向整个区域广播。 二、关键技术 1. 调制与解调:劳拉系统使用特殊的调制技术,如幅度键控(ASK)和相位键控(PSK),通过改变散射信号的幅度和相位来编码二进制数据。在接收端,通过解调器对散射信号进行分析,恢复原始信息。 2. 信道编码与解码:为了提高通信的可靠性,劳拉系统通常会应用信道编码技术,如卷积编码或循环冗余校验(CRC),以检测和纠正传输错误。解码过程则是在接收端进行,以还原出无误的原始数据。 3. 能量采集:由于反向散射通信的低功耗特性,劳拉系统常常结合能量采集技术,如太阳能或射频能量采集,以实现自供电,进一步降低设备的运行成本。 三、Python在劳拉系统中的应用 1. 数据处理:Python语言的强大数据处理能力使其成为构建劳拉系统软件框架的理想选择。可以使用Python进行信号捕获、处理、编码和解码等任务,处理从FM信号到数据的转换。 2. 模拟与仿真:Python拥有丰富的科学计算库,如NumPy和SciPy,可用于模拟和优化劳拉系统的通信性能,评估不同参数设置对通信距离和误码率的影响。 3. 设备控制:Python还可以用于编写控制设备硬件的操作程序,如控制反向散射天线的开关,调整散射信号的幅度和相位。 4. 应用开发:Python的易用性和丰富的第三方库支持快速开发基于劳拉系统的物联网应用,如远程监控、智能传感器网络等。 总结来说,“劳拉”系统通过创新的反向散射通信方式,利用环境FM信号进行长距离通信,展示了在物联网领域的巨大潜力。结合Python的编程优势,我们可以构建高效、可靠的通信解决方案,为未来的智能世界注入更多可能。
- 1
- 粉丝: 37
- 资源: 4508
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 风机变桨控制基于FAST与MATLAB SIMULINK联合仿真模型非线性风力发电机的 PID独立变桨和统一变桨控制下仿真模型,对于5WM非线性风机风机进行控制 链接simulink的scope出转速
- Spring+Spring MVC+MyBatis实现敛书网
- Scrapy框架-xpath爬取豆瓣电影top250电影信息
- python俄罗斯方块游戏
- 正点原子RK3588平台,运行在Android14的realtek 的wifi驱动(rtl8733bu)
- python贪吃蛇小游戏
- 超级有趣的表白代码圣诞树源代码100%好用.zip
- python定时清理朝超出容量限制的日志任务
- Renci.SshNet.dll
- 超级好的表白代码圣诞树html源代码100%好用.zip
评论0